This type of packaging, which disintegrates into valuable agricultural compost when disposed in compost facilities or in home compost piles, can be used for shipping items to consumers, packaging items purchased in stores, and by brands logistical teams to store and ship materials and finished items all along the supply chain. Similarly, resin producers are developing polymers based on feedstock made from chemical recycling of plastic waste; this feedstock can replace oil- and gas-based feedstock in manufacturing plastic substrates used for packaging materials, and packaging end-products can then be tagged as made from recycled plastic. Measures announced in May 2019, under the New EU Directive for Single-Use Plastics, aim to reduce leakage of the ten single-use plastic products most often found on European beaches.5Circular Economy: Commission welcomes Council final adoption of new rules on single-use plastics to reduce marine plastic litter, European Commission press release, May 21, 2019, ec.europa.eu.
